X-Git-Url: https://git.arvados.org/arvados-workbench2.git/blobdiff_plain/ba5b505f1cda78dafa9e17df7af33c9ae2c6829d..7f137c5a4162717b74668a513b8b10a1ed3d8577:/src/views/favorite-panel/favorite-panel.tsx diff --git a/src/views/favorite-panel/favorite-panel.tsx b/src/views/favorite-panel/favorite-panel.tsx index 6ba05b06..4ba967c0 100644 --- a/src/views/favorite-panel/favorite-panel.tsx +++ b/src/views/favorite-panel/favorite-panel.tsx @@ -31,6 +31,7 @@ import { ContainerRequestState } from "~/models/container-request"; import { FavoritesState } from '../../store/favorites/favorites-reducer'; import { RootState } from '~/store/store'; import { PanelDefaultView } from '~/components/panel-default-view/panel-default-view'; +import { DataTableDefaultView } from '~/components/data-table-default-view/data-table-default-view'; type CssRules = "toolbar" | "button"; @@ -64,16 +65,14 @@ export const favoritePanelColumns: DataColumns = [ configurable: true, sortDirection: SortDirection.ASC, filters: [], - render: uuid => , - width: "450px" + render: uuid => }, { name: "Status", selected: true, configurable: true, filters: [], - render: uuid => , - width: "75px" + render: uuid => }, { name: FavoritePanelColumnNames.TYPE, @@ -96,24 +95,21 @@ export const favoritePanelColumns: DataColumns = [ type: ResourceKind.PROJECT } ], - render: uuid => , - width: "125px" + render: uuid => }, { name: FavoritePanelColumnNames.OWNER, selected: true, configurable: true, filters: [], - render: uuid => , - width: "200px" + render: uuid => }, { name: FavoritePanelColumnNames.FILE_SIZE, selected: true, configurable: true, filters: [], - render: uuid => , - width: "50px" + render: uuid => }, { name: FavoritePanelColumnNames.LAST_MODIFIED, @@ -121,8 +117,7 @@ export const favoritePanelColumns: DataColumns = [ configurable: true, sortDirection: SortDirection.NONE, filters: [], - render: uuid => , - width: "150px" + render: uuid => } ]; @@ -169,22 +164,18 @@ export const FavoritePanel = withStyles(styles)( connect(mapStateToProps, mapDispatchToProps)( class extends React.Component { render() { - return this.hasAnyFavorites() - ? - : ; - } - - hasAnyFavorites = () => { - return Object - .keys(this.props.favorites) - .find(uuid => this.props.favorites[uuid]); + return + } />; } } )